When it comes to pairing up a dish with zesty flavors, cilantro lime rice shines brightly. Imagine sitting down to a warm plate of tacos or a spicy grilled chicken. What elevates that experience?
Yes, the perfect sidekick – cilantro lime rice. It’s fresh, fragrant, and brings a wonderful burst of flavor. I’ve had moments where a simple meal transformed into something memorable, all thanks to this dish.
Before delving into our cilantro lime rice recipe, let’s talk about why this recipe stands out. The combination of creamy, rich textures with vibrant lime and cilantro flavors is simply irresistible.
Plus, this dish is light and healthy, making it a guilt-free addition to any meal. I’ve whipped this up time and again, and each time, it becomes a star attraction on the dinner table. It’s a great way to make simple meals feel celebratory without much fuss.

You’ll Also Like These Recipes
What Ingredients Make Cilantro Lime Rice Special?
As a food enthusiast and registered dietitian, I’ve learned that the quality of ingredients can make a world of difference. Let me share a bit about the ingredients we’ll be working with for this recipe.
- Rice: I usually opt for long-grain white rice. It’s fluffy and has a nice bite. If you want something with a nuttier flavor, you can use brown rice.
- Chicken Broth or Water: I prefer using low-sodium chicken broth for depth. The flavor infuses beautifully into the rice.
- Fresh Lime Juice: Nothing compares to the brightness of fresh lime. It wakes up the dish and gives it that signature zing.
- Extra-Virgin Olive Oil: This is my go-to for richness. A splash brings the rice together and enhances its texture.
- Garlic: Finely minced, it adds a delightful aroma and depth to the flavor profile.
- Kosher Salt: This helps balance the taste. Be cautious with the amount if using broth.
- Fresh Cilantro: Chopped finely, it contributes a fresh, herbaceous note that truly defines this dish.
- Green Onion: Thinly sliced, it adds a touch of sharpness and crunch.
- Ground Cumin: Just a hint gives a warm undertone, enhancing the overall flavor without being overpowering.
The simplicity yet vibrancy of these ingredients is what makes this recipe shine.
Ingredients List
Here’s what you’ll need to get started:
- 1 cup uncooked long-grain white rice
- 1½ cups low-sodium chicken broth or water
- 2 tablespoons fresh lime juice (from about 1 lime)
- 1 tablespoon extra-virgin olive oil
- 1 garlic clove, finely minced
- ½ teaspoon kosher salt, or to taste
- ½ cup fresh cilantro, chopped
- 1 green onion, thinly sliced
- ⅛ teaspoon ground cumin

How to Make Cilantro Lime Rice
Now, let’s roll up our sleeves and dive into the cooking process. Follow these steps closely for a flawless cilantro lime rice experience.
Step 1: Rinse the Rice
Before cooking, it’s best to rinse the rice under cold water. This removes excess starch and helps achieve that fluffy texture. Just a minute or two under a gentle stream of cold water will do the trick.
Step 2: Cook the Rice
In a medium saucepan, combine the rinsed rice and the low-sodium chicken broth or water. Bring this mixture to a boil over medium-high heat. Once boiling, reduce the heat to low. Cover the pan and let it simmer for about 18-20 minutes. This allows the rice to absorb the liquid completely.
Step 3: Fluff the Rice
Once the rice has cooked and all the liquid is absorbed, remove the pot from heat. Let it sit covered for another 5 minutes. This resting period is essential. After that, grab a fork and fluff the rice gently.
Step 4: Mix in the Good Stuff
In a small mixing bowl, combine the lime juice, olive oil, minced garlic, salt, and ground cumin. Whisk this mixture until everything is well blended. Pour it over the fluffed rice, then toss to coat evenly.
Step 5: Add Fresh Ingredients
Now, fold in the fresh cilantro and green onions. These ingredients give the dish freshness and color. Mix gently to avoid breaking the rice grains.
Step 6: Serve and Enjoy
You can serve this cilantro lime rice warm or at room temperature. It’s versatile and makes an excellent option for meal prepping.
Nutrition Information
Recipe Notes
Rice
Using long-grain white rice provides that fluffy texture. However, brown rice is a nutritious choice and can also be used. If you opt for brown rice, remember to adjust the cooking time.
Chicken Broth or Water
The use of low-sodium chicken broth enhances the flavor significantly. Water can be a substitute; however, broth brings depth that plain water simply can’t.
Fresh Lime Juice
Lime juice is essential. Freshly squeezed juice adds a bright burst compared to bottled varieties. You’ll taste the difference!
Extra-Virgin Olive Oil
Opting for high-quality extra-virgin olive oil makes a difference in flavor. It’s worth investing in a good bottle for cooking and drizzling.
Garlic
Garlic is best used fresh. Note that using garlic powder can alter the taste. Fresh garlic brings a punch that powder just can’t replicate.
Fresh Cilantro
Cilantro is key in this dish. If you’re unsure about the taste of cilantro, you can adjust the amount based on your preference or replace it with parsley for a milder flavor.

Recipe Variations
Explore different worlds with these variations. Consider adding black beans or corn for extra texture and color. You could mix in chopped tomatoes for freshness or even some diced avocados for creaminess. If you’re in the mood for something spicy, a pinch of cayenne pepper can do the trick. You can modify this dish to match your palate or dietary needs.

Cilantro Lime Rice Recipe
Equipment
- Saucepan, Bowl
Ingredients
- 1 cup uncooked long-grain white rice
- 1½ cups low-sodium chicken broth or water
- 2 tablespoons fresh lime juice from about 1 lime
- 1 tablespoon extra-virgin olive oil
- 1 garlic clove finely minced
- ½ teaspoon kosher salt or to taste
- ½ cup fresh cilantro chopped
- 1 green onion thinly sliced
- ⅛ teaspoon ground cumin
Instructions
Step 1: Rinse the Rice
- Before cooking, it’s best to rinse the rice under cold water. This removes excess starch and helps achieve that fluffy texture. Just a minute or two under a gentle stream of cold water will do the trick.
Step 2: Cook the Rice
- In a medium saucepan, combine the rinsed rice and the low-sodium chicken broth or water. Bring this mixture to a boil over medium-high heat. Once boiling, reduce the heat to low. Cover the pan and let it simmer for about 18-20 minutes. This allows the rice to absorb the liquid completely.
Step 3: Fluff the Rice
- Once the rice has cooked and all the liquid is absorbed, remove the pot from heat. Let it sit covered for another 5 minutes. This resting period is essential. After that, grab a fork and fluff the rice gently.
Step 4: Mix in the Good Stuff
- In a small mixing bowl, combine the lime juice, olive oil, minced garlic, salt, and ground cumin. Whisk this mixture until everything is well blended. Pour it over the fluffed rice, then toss to coat evenly.
Step 5: Add Fresh Ingredients
- Now, fold in the fresh cilantro and green onions. These ingredients give the dish freshness and color. Mix gently to avoid breaking the rice grains.
Step 6: Serve and Enjoy
- You can serve this cilantro lime rice warm or at room temperature. It’s versatile and makes an excellent option for meal prepping.
Notes
Rice
Using long-grain white rice provides that fluffy texture. However, brown rice is a nutritious choice and can also be used. If you opt for brown rice, remember to adjust the cooking time.Chicken Broth or Water
The use of low-sodium chicken broth enhances the flavor significantly. Water can be a substitute; however, broth brings depth that plain water simply can’t.Fresh Lime Juice
Lime juice is essential. Freshly squeezed juice adds a bright burst compared to bottled varieties. You’ll taste the difference!Extra-Virgin Olive Oil
Opting for high-quality extra-virgin olive oil makes a difference in flavor. It’s worth investing in a good bottle for cooking and drizzling.Garlic
Garlic is best used fresh. Note that using garlic powder can alter the taste. Fresh garlic brings a punch that powder just can’t replicate.Fresh Cilantro
Cilantro is key in this dish. If you’re unsure about the taste of cilantro, you can adjust the amount based on your preference or replace it with parsley for a milder flavor.Nutrition
FAQs
Can I use brown rice instead?
Yes! Brown rice is a nutritious alternative. Just remember to increase the cooking time to about 40-45 minutes. You’ll also want to double-check that water-to-rice ratio, as brown rice usually requires more liquid.
Can I make this recipe vegan?
Absolutely! Substitute the chicken broth with vegetable broth or just stick with water. Other than that, all the ingredients are plant-based
How do I store leftovers?
Store any leftovers in an airtight container in the refrigerator. It’ll keep well for about 3-4 days. You can reheat it in a microwave or on the stovetop with a splash of water for moisture.
Can I use dried herbs instead of fresh?
While fresh herbs provide a vibrant flavor, dried herbs can work in a pinch. Use about one-third the amount of fresh herbs since dried herbs are more concentrated.
What dishes pair well with cilantro lime rice?
This rice pairs exceptionally well with grilled chicken, fish, tacos, fajitas, or as a base for a burrito bowl. It’s versatile enough to complement any protein.
Can I freeze cilantro lime rice?
Yes, freezing is an option! Allow it to cool completely, then transfer it to an airtight container. It’ll last in the freezer for up to three months.
Conclusion
Cilantro lime rice is not just a side dish; it’s a burst of flavor that brings meals to life. I’ve watched many friends become fans after just one taste. Whether you’re preparing a casual dinner or a festive gathering, this recipe fits perfectly. Minimal ingredients can create a stunning dish packed with freshness.
So next time you’re in the kitchen, why not give this zesty delight a try? I promise it will become a regular feature on your dinner table. Pair it with your favorite proteins or salads, and watch as your meals transform into something spectacular. Now, grab your ingredients and get cooking… it’s time for a cilantro lime rice experience!